About Wiolka

Wiolka, a diminutive of Wiola, originated from the Old French "violette" and Latin "vĭŏla," which ultimately stemmed from the Ancient Greek "íon," meaning "violet" or "dark blue flower." The name holds an auspicious connotation, referencing the fragrant flower of the same name.
